A technique I learnt in a recent Photoshop tutorial, is the ability to create a panoramic photograph. All you need is multiple photos of one landscape/scene. In Photoshop click File- Automate – Photomerge. (see first image) A box will appear that will have many options with to play with. To keep this basic, load up […]
